Overview of this book

MLOps with OpenShift offers practical insights for implementing MLOps workflows on the dynamic OpenShift platform. As organizations worldwide seek to harness the power of machine learning operations, this book lays the foundation for your MLOps success. Starting with an exploration of key MLOps concepts, including data preparation, model training, and deployment, you’ll prepare to unleash OpenShift capabilities, kicking off with a primer on containers, pods, operators, and more. With the groundwork in place, you’ll be guided to MLOps workflows, uncovering the applications of popular machine learning frameworks for training and testing models on the platform. As you advance through the chapters, you’ll focus on the open-source data science and machine learning platform, Red Hat OpenShift Data Science, and its partner components, such as Pachyderm and Intel OpenVino, to understand their role in building and managing data pipelines, as well as deploying and monitoring machine learning models. Armed with this comprehensive knowledge, you’ll be able to implement MLOps workflows on the OpenShift platform proficiently.

Summary

In this chapter, you have seen how Red Hat ODS integrates with third-party software to further simplify your MLOps journey. OpenShift makes it a breeze to use the data versioning capabilities of the Pachyderm software.

You have seen how Red Hat OpenShift Pipelines enables your data science team to automate the model training workflow by providing drag-and-drop capabilities and using the same code you have used to manually train the model.

You will use the core pipeline capabilities in the next few chapters, where you'll further automate your workflow. In the next chapter, you will use what you have learned about creating pipelines to deploy the model as a service.
